Mixed options sentiment in Occidental Petroleum (OXY), with shares down 92c near $58.84. Options volume running well above average with 91k contracts traded and calls leading puts for a put/call ratio of 0.21, compared to a typical level near 0.3. Implied volatility (IV30) dropped 3.5 near 40.65,in the top quartile of the past year, suggesting an expected daily move of $1.51. Put-call skew flattened, suggesting a modestly bullish tone.
